FCS Financial is governed by a 15-person board. Of those, 12 are elected by the stockholders of FCS Financial. Additionally, the board has appointed three directors. The board meets monthly and provides overall direction to the organization's leadership. Jim lives in Williamsburg where he farms in partnership with his brother and two sons.
